首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React表排序和搜索

是指在使用React框架开发前端应用时,对表格数据进行排序和搜索的功能。通过这个功能,用户可以方便地对表格中的数据进行排序和搜索,提高数据的查找和浏览效率。

React表排序和搜索的实现可以借助React的状态管理和事件处理机制。以下是一个完善且全面的答案:

概念: React表排序和搜索是指在React框架中,对表格数据进行排序和搜索的功能。

分类: React表排序和搜索可以分为两个功能模块:排序和搜索。

优势:

  1. 提高数据查找和浏览效率:通过排序功能,用户可以按照指定的字段对表格数据进行升序或降序排列,方便快速查找所需数据。通过搜索功能,用户可以输入关键词进行模糊匹配,快速筛选出符合条件的数据。
  2. 提升用户体验:React表排序和搜索功能可以使用户在大量数据中快速找到所需信息,提高用户的使用效率和满意度。

应用场景: React表排序和搜索功能适用于任何需要展示大量数据的场景,例如管理系统中的数据列表、电商平台的商品列表等。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列与React开发相关的产品和服务,可以帮助开发者更好地实现React表排序和搜索功能。以下是一些推荐的腾讯云产品和产品介绍链接地址:

  1. 云服务器(CVM):提供稳定可靠的云服务器,支持自定义配置和弹性伸缩,满足不同规模应用的需求。产品介绍链接
  2. 云数据库MySQL版(CDB):提供高性能、高可用的云数据库服务,支持数据的存储和查询。产品介绍链接
  3. 云函数(SCF):无服务器函数计算服务,可以用于处理前端应用中的业务逻辑。产品介绍链接
  4. 对象存储(COS):提供安全可靠的云端存储服务,用于存储前端应用中的静态资源和文件。产品介绍链接
  5. API网关(API Gateway):提供灵活、高性能的API网关服务,用于管理和发布前端应用的API接口。产品介绍链接

通过使用以上腾讯云产品,开发者可以构建出具备React表排序和搜索功能的前端应用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

lua排序

对于lua的table排序问题,一般的使用大多是按照value值来排序,使用table.sort( needSortTable , func)即可(可以根据自己的需要重写func,否则会根据默认来:默认的情形之下...,如果内既有string,number类型,则会因为两个类型直接compare而出错,所以需要自己写func来转换一下;也可根据自己的需要在此func中 添加相应的逻辑来达到你的 排序要求); local...end –输出结果为: 1 one 2 two 3 three 如此是达到我们的目的了,但是这个只能支持下表为整形的table(即是放在table数组部分的,...luaH_set 10 luaH_present 48 luaH_get 24 1 table: 027EE6E8 [Finished in 0.1s] 如此这般 即可实现按照键值对的排序了...;这样的实现方式其实与上述将table的索引存入一个temp中,并将此temp按func排序;只不过这里 使用闭包,将此处理放置在了一个方法内来替代pairs罢了;

2.7K110

数据结构与算法 - 排序搜索排序搜索

文章来源:数据结构与算法(Python) 排序搜索 排序算法(英语:Sorting algorithm)是一种能将一串数据依照特定顺序进行排列的一种算法。...递归地(recursive)把小于基准值元素的子数列大于基准值元素的子数列排序。 3.递归的最底部情形,是数列的大小是零或一,也就是永远都已经被排序好了。...希尔排序过程 希尔排序的基本思想是:将数组列在一个中并对列分别进行插入排序,重复这过程,不过每次用更长的列(步长更长了,列数更少了)来进行。最后整个就只有一列了。...8.搜索 搜索是在一个项目集合中找到一个特定项目的算法过程。搜索通常的答案是真的或假的,因为该项目是否存在。...搜索的几种常见方法:顺序查找、二分法查找、二叉树查找、哈希查找 二分法查找 二分查找又称折半查找,优点是比较次数少,查找速度快,平均性能好;其缺点是要求待查表为有序,且插入删除困难。

78330

【技术分享】七:搜索排序排序模型

这部分涉及到模型的选择,优化目标以及损失函数的选取。排序由第一节讲到,LTR有三个模式,分别是pointwise, pairwise,listwise。...直到达到停止条件,于是GBDT的预测就是N个棵树预测的结果的加。 2.jpg 2:项目实践 项目的背景建模可以看第三节:搜索排序——机器学习化建模 在部分,将展示基于三种不同的优化目标下的结果。...系列文章: 【技术分享】一:搜索排序—概述 https://cloud.tencent.com/developer/article/1523867 【技术分析】二:搜索排序—工业流程 https://cloud.tencent.com...技术分享】四:搜索排序—数据的采集与构造 https://cloud.tencent.com/developer/article/1528253 【技术分享】五:搜索排序-特征分析 https://cloud.tencent.com.../developer/article/1531448 【技术分析】六:搜索排序—指标介绍与选择 https://cloud.tencent.com/developer/article/1532635

4.1K51

React Table 表格组件使用教程 排序、分页、搜索过滤筛选功能实战开发

跟随本文你将学到如何使用 react-table 在 React 中搭建表格组件如何使用 react-table 表格组件进行数据的分页、排序搜索过滤筛选react-table 实战案例:手把手教你使用...react-table 表格组件实战分页、排序搜索过滤筛选图片扩展阅读:《顶级好用的 React 表单设计生成器,可拖拽生成表单》react-table 安装使用首先,让我们先来创建一个 React...扩展阅读:《7 款最棒的开源 React 移动端 UI 组件库模版框架 - 特别针对国内使用场景推荐》React Table 表格排序功能如果只是想设置默认排序,我们可以通过配置 initialState...扩展阅读:《7 款最棒的开源 React UI 组件库模版框架测评 - 特别针对国内使用场景推荐》React Table 表格搜索过滤筛选功能我们可以通过 useFilters 来实现筛选功能:import...扩展阅读:《最好用的 5 个 React select 多选下拉菜单组件测评推荐》React table 排序搜索过滤筛选、分页示例代码通过前文我们已经把 react-table 的基本使用都演示了一遍

16.1K00

PHPCMS搜索结果排序问题

PHPCMS默认的搜索结果是越旧的文章排在越前面,缺少活度。在网上的解决办法把最新的文章排在前面,其实我觉得最相关的文章排在前面才是最合适的。...修改的页面:phpcmsmodulessearchindex.php 搜索 $data = $this->content_db->select($where, "*"); 最新文章排在前面,就把代码替换为...,则加2分,没出现则0分,按照分值排序,最后才是按照文章id排序 上面只提到了标题,如果还需要把内容的因素加进去,可以替换为 $data = $this->content_db->select("title...v9_news,中只有描述没有内容。...如果你会合并2个就可以把descripton改成content 但是按相关度排序的文章无法进行分页,暂时还没想到什么解决办法。

5.1K40

数据结构之美:如何优化搜索排序算法

文章目录 搜索算法的优化 1. 二分搜索 2. 哈希 排序算法的优化 1. 快速排序 2....❤️ 数据结构算法是计算机科学中的基础概念,它们在软件开发中起着至关重要的作用。在众多的数据操作中,搜索排序是最常见的两种操作。...本文将探讨如何通过优化搜索排序算法来提高算法性能,并介绍一些常见的数据结构算法优化技巧。 搜索算法的优化 搜索算法的目标是在给定数据集中查找特定元素的位置。...常见的搜索算法包括线性搜索、二分搜索哈希等。下面将介绍如何优化这些搜索算法。 1. 二分搜索 二分搜索是一种高效的搜索算法,但要求数据集必须是有序的。...哈希 哈希是一种高效的搜索数据结构,它可以在常量时间内完成搜索操作。哈希通过将键映射到特定的索引来实现快速搜索

19021

BERT在美团搜索核心排序的探索实践

为进一步优化美团搜索排序结果的深度语义相关性,提升用户体验,搜索与NLP部算法团队从2019年底开始基于BERT优化美团搜索排序相关性,经过三个月的算法迭代优化,离线线上效果均取得一定进展。...搜索QueryDoc的相关性直接反映结果页排序的优劣,将相关性高的Doc排在前面,能提高用户搜索决策效率搜索体验。...1 裁剪知识蒸馏方式效果对比 在美团搜索核心排序的业务场景下,我们采用知识蒸馏使得BERT模型在对响应时间要求苛刻的搜索场景下符合了上线的要求,并且效果无显著的性能损失。...2 线上AB效果对比(*表示AB一周稳定正向) 从2可以看出,各项优化对线上排序核心指标都带来稳定的提升。...语义相关性是影响搜索体验的重要因素之一,我们将BERT相关性排序模型进行端到端联合训练,将相关性点击率目标进行多目标联合优化,提升美团搜索排序的综合体验。

2K1919

线性排序

# 线性排序 本文已归档到:「blog」 本文中的示例代码已归档到:「algorithm-tutorial」 # 冒泡排序 # 要点 冒泡排序是一种交换排序。 什么是交换排序呢?...交换排序:两两比较待排序的关键字,并交换不满足次序要求的那对数,直到整个都满足次序要求为止。 # 算法思想 它重复地走访过要排序的数列,一次比较两个元素,如果他们的顺序错误就把他们交换过来。...若将两个有序合并成一个有序,称为二路归并。...# 算法思想 将待排序序列 R [0...n-1] 看成是 n 个长度为 1 的有序序列,将相邻的有序成对归并,得到 n/2 个长度为 2 的有序;将这些有序序列再次归并,得到 n/4 个长度为 4...数据结构 线性 排序

55020

【NumPy 数组连接、拆分、搜索排序

在 SQL 中,我们基于键来连接,而在 NumPy 中,我们按轴连接数组。 我们传递了一系列要与轴一起连接到 concatenate() 函数的数组。如果未显式传递轴,则将其视为 0。...我们使用 array_split() 分割数组,将要分割的数组分割数传递给它。...dsplit() 可以使用与 vstack() dstack() 类似的替代方法 NumPy 数组搜索 搜索数组 您可以在数组中搜索(检索)某个值,然后返回获得匹配的索引。...查找值为奇数的索引: import numpy as np arr = np.array([1, 2, 3, 4, 5, 6, 7, 8]) x = np.where(arr%2 == 1) print(x) 搜索排序...该方法从右边开始搜索,并返回第一个索引,其中数字 7 不再小于下一个值。 多个值 要搜索多个值,请使用拥有指定值的数组。

13810

【技术分享】一:搜索排序—概述

1: 搜索排序的概念 搜索排序:在一次会话中,用户在交互界面输入需要查询的query,系统给返回其排好序的doc例的过程。...2:搜索排序推荐排序的区别 推荐:基于用户的行为挖掘出用户的兴趣,为其推荐对应的视频,doc等。...2.1从展示形式来讲: 搜索排序每次展示一系列的消息例,如下图所示: 推荐每次可以展示一条消息,但是我们看到的这条可以被展示的doc也是经过背后的排序算法得到的。...3:对排序的理解 排序;顾名思义,就是从一堆杂乱的例中依据某些特征进行排序。...4:排序的常见算法 搜索排序可以大致分为两个阶段: 先是召回,然后是排序排序里面又分为粗排精排,拍完之后,为了预防某些badcase,还会有产品的干预,这个在下一节中讲到。

4.5K64
领券